Geocache Description:

CCC Night Out will continue the outdoors theme trying to hold on to the last bit of summer. This month we're going back east of the river to Riverfront Park in Glastonbury.

As with the previous outdoor get togethers, this one will also be BYOPD (Bring your own Picnic Dinner). There is a covered pavilion, so we can still get meet whether rain or shine. Main Street in Glastonbury offers plenty of places to pick up food on our way to the park if needed. Since it gets dark around 8pm (we're loosin a couple of min a day ), and there arent any lights wanted to start the event earlier than usual at 6pm.

Coordinates are for the park entrance. The pavilion is down on the right with plenty of parking nearby.


Riverfront Park
200 Welles Street, Glastonbury, CT
Tuesday, September 14th at 6 p.m.
Raine or shine, it's covered







If you have children, there's a nice gravel path where they can ride their bike. Plus, there's plenty of room to play Frisbee, soccer or just run around in the huge, grass field.


If you are interested in paddling before the event, there is car-top access to Keeney Cove at N 41° 43.153 W 072° 37.610. With some nearby caches. Please note that
the launch area closes at sunset.



The Central Connecticut Cacher's Nite Out is an evening gathering on the second Tuesday of every month (well, most months anyway). Mark your calendars now! Anyone and everyone is welcome to attend...you don't have to reside in CT, and you certainly don't have to be an experienced cacher...new folks are most welcome! Let us know if this is your first event as we'd like to get acquainted.

This event features new or rotating hosts every month, and changing locations. If you have an interest in hosting, please contact KD&MS. As host, you'll select a location; get the coordinates; and copy and paste the event page and resubmit. There are a number of places in the Greater Hartford area to enjoy good food and drinks. Locations should be kid friendly, have no admission fee and be within the Central Connecticut/Greater Hartford area. Cachers from outside of the area are also encouraged to host, but we do ask that the event itself be held in the central CT area.
